  • Publication number: 20230396747
    Abstract: The present invention discloses a multiple camera sensor system and a method for any application and for a large number of different fields. The present invention is solving certain problems related to existing camera technology issues by introducing the possibility of getting several different camera inputs from the same source or moving shots/images without physically moving any cameras. It will minimize the physical presence of existing camera technology, size, weight and design and also to large extent avoid physical laws like gravity, vibrations, acceleration, retardation and speed. This may be implemented by means of a software virtually moving camera using multiple cameras sensors mounted consecutively along some attachment solution. This attachment solution may include e.g. tape or strips. The invention can be utilized in areas like industry and production support, medical appliances, AV production, Video Conferencing, Broadcast, Surveillance and Security among others.

  • Patent number: 10604029
    Abstract: The present embodiments relate to a trolley system for a camera dolly. The system comprising at least one trolley comprising a power drive for driving the trolley in both a forward and reverse direction, a cable handling and a storage arrangement; a station for operative connection to the at least one trolley; one cable connecting the station and the at least one trolley; a power device for supplying power to the trolley; and at least one rail adapted to receive the at least one trolley, the at least one rail comprising at least one rail recess, and the cable handling and storage arrangement is adapted to deploy the at least one cable in the at least one rail recess as the trolley moves away from the station and take up the at least one cable from the at least one rail recess as the trolley moves toward the station.

  • Patent number: 9868450
    Abstract: A dolly system is disclosed, which overcomes drawbacks related to unwanted noise and jerks of prior art dolly systems. The dolly system comprises wheel assemblies (130) that have independently rotating lateral support wheels (132, 133) in combination with a center wheel (131) that interact with a continuous resilient element (122) when rolling along a rail track, without encountering any gaps or bumps and without producing squeal noise due to so-called wheel-climbing that may occur in curves along the rail track.
